In June 2010 it was announced that the family law team was to be transferred to a newly established firm, Silk Family Law. Current heads of family law at Dickinson Dees, Margaret Simpson and Ian Kennerley, are setting up Silk Family Law as a specialist law firm dealing solely in family legal matters and plan to establish their firm from Dickinson Dees' existing family team, to be based in offices in Newcastle and Yorkshire.

We are now one of a growing group of lawyers who are trained in collaborative law. This process brings together both parties and their legal representatives, to discuss the issues and to explore the possibility of reaching a negotiated settlement rather than having to take the case to court. The positive benefit for the client is that collaborative law provides the potential for more flexible, tailor-made solutions than are usually possible through the court process.
